Reshoring for sustainable pump production

The UK’s Apex Pumps has invested in domestic production, advanced machining, and renewable energy to improve sustainability and strengthen supply chains.

Sustainability and supply chain resilience are now central to how pumps are designed and manufactured. Across global markets, there is growing pressure to reduce environmental impact while continuing to maintain the reliability and performance expected in demanding industrial applications.

In response, many manufacturers are increasing investment in domestic production. At Apex Pumps, this has taken the form of expanding UK-based manufacturing capability, bringing more machining processes in-house and reducing reliance on overseas suppliers. This approach reflects a wider industry shift towards reshoring, driven by the need for greater control over quality, lead times, and supply chain risk.

Machinery investment
Investment in modern CNC machining has played a key role in this transition. Technologies such as the Mazak Quick Turn lathe and HCN NEO horizontal machining centre allow for higher precision and consistency, which are particularly important in centrifugal pump components where small variations can significantly affect long-term performance.

For Apex Pumps, these capabilities support the production of bespoke, application-specific designs while maintaining the consistent quality standards associated with British engineering and the company’s Made in Britain membership.

Shorter supply chains are another important outcome. Manufacturing closer to the end user improves agility, supports more reliable on-time delivery, and reduces transport emissions – an increasingly relevant factor as sustainability targets become more closely scrutinised. Producing pumps in the UK for both domestic and global markets enables faster delivery while maintaining tighter control over the manufacturing process.

Sustainability
Alongside developments in production, there is a growing emphasis on measurable sustainability improvements within manufacturing operations.

Apex Pumps has invested in on-site renewable energy generation, including a 150kW solar array, which produced 175MWh of renewable energy in its first year. This contributed to a 37.8% reduction in grid electricity use and an overall 40% drop in CO2e emissions compared to a 2023 baseline.

These measures have received industry recognition, with Apex Pumps named Runner Up for Sustainability Initiative of the Year at the Made in Britain Impact Awards and Winner of the Sustainable Contribution for a Better World category at the BPMA Pump Industry Awards 2026.

Reshoring has also supported reductions in transport-related emissions by limiting the need for overseas sourcing. Combined with investment in modern facilities and expanded production space, this approach enables increased capacity without compromising product quality or impacting environmental performance.

Reliability remains central to pump design, particularly in applications where downtime is not an option. At Apex Pumps, designing for durability and long service life helps reduce maintenance and extend product lifespan, lowering overall environmental impact.

Case study: Microplastic filtration
Apex Pumps works closely with sustainable companies such as Matter, whose filtration technology is designed to capture microplastics before they enter water systems, supporting more sustainable industrial processes.

Used in industrial applications, these systems rely on consistent flow and reliable pump performance to maintain filtration efficiency.

Pumps play a critical role in ensuring stable operation, where downtime or variation can impact results. Matter’s work has gained international recognition, including the Earthshot Prize, highlighting the growing importance of solutions addressing water quality.

The partnership reflects a shared focus on sustainability, demonstrating how pump engineering can support emerging environmental technologies.
